WebThis test aims to try to deduce the length of the keyword used in the cipher. To do this, cryptanalyst looks for repeated characters in text (trigrams or more) and measures the distance between them. WebIt is a simplest form of substitution cipher scheme. This cryptosystem is generally referred to as the Shift Cipher. The concept is to replace each alphabet by another alphabet which is ‘shifted’ by some fixed number between 0 and 25. For this type of scheme, both sender and receiver agree on a ‘secret shift number’ for shifting the alphabet. WebCiphers and Message Digest algorithms are identified by a unique EVP_CIPHER and EVP_MD object respectively. You are not expected to create these yourself, but instead use one of the built in functions to return one for the particular algorithm that you wish to use. Refer to the evp.h header file for the complete list of ciphers and message digests.
